AI costs are now outpacing human labor costs at big tech companies. Uber's CTO already blew through his entire 2026 AI budget in 2025. It cost more than the human workers in that department while tartup founders are bragging about their AI bills as a badge of seriousness. VCs are asking about token spend as a signal of commitment. The macro number: worldwide IT spending is expected to be up 13.5% this year to over $6 trillion. Most of the incremental spend is going straight to token costs and enterprise contracts with OpenAI, Anthropic, Google and others. The original premise was simple: AI cuts costs. Replace expensive humans with cheaper compute. The actual pattern emerging is the opposite. The companies most committed to AI are spending more. High token usage has become a signal of AI seriousness. Two possible interpretations: One: AI is delivering productivity gains faster than expected and the ROI already justifies the cost. Uber's CTO blew his 2026 budget in 2025 because AI was producing results worth more than what was budgeted. Two: AI has become a competitive arms race where you have to keep spending just to stay relevant, regardless of near-term ROI. Either way, the beneficiaries are the same: the companies selling the tokens. OpenAI, Anthropic and the infrastructure beneath them are capturing every dollar of this spending surge.

AI Hardware Demand Growth and Representative US-Listed Companies June 2026 Executive Summary Nvidia’s transition to the Vera Rubin (VR200) platform marks a significant escalation in AI infrastructure complexity and cost. Our BOM teardown of the next-generation Rubin rack reveals a ~2x increase in total rack cost to approximately $7.8 million (vs. ~$4 million for GB300), driven not solely by the GPU/CPU but by sharp revaluations across the supply chain. Key highlights from downstream components include: • PCB content value +233% YoY, the largest increase. • MLCC +182%, reflecting higher density and count (e.g., ~600k MLCCs per VR200 NVL72 server, +30%+ vs. GB300). • ABF substrates +82%, power solutions +32%, and liquid cooling +12%. These upgrades align with broader AI scaling: 800G/1.6T optical transceivers ramping aggressively, glass-based technologies advancing for packaging and interconnects, and hyperscalers prioritizing performance, power efficiency, and thermal management. We expect sustained multi-year tailwinds for the AI hardware ecosystem into 2027+, with Rubin-driven demand accelerating in H2 2026. Investment Thesis: While Nvidia (NVDA) remains the core beneficiary, the supply chain offers diversified exposure. We favor companies with direct exposure to high-growth areas like advanced PCBs, high-speed optics, and glass substrates/optical interconnects. Risks include execution on new capacity, potential margin pressure from rapid scaling, and geopolitical supply chain factors. 1. PCB: Sharpest Value Uplift in Rubin BOM Morgan Stanley’s detailed analysis shows PCB content in the Rubin rack surging +233% versus GB300. This reflects needs for higher layer counts, advanced materials, better signal integrity, and larger formats to support increased power and interconnect density in AI servers. US Representative: TTM Technologies (TTMI) – Leading US PCB manufacturer with strong positioning in high-complexity boards for data center/AI applications. TTM has invested in capacity expansions (e.g., new facilities) to capture AI-driven demand for advanced HDI and high-layer PCBs. 2. MLCC: Density-Driven Surge Nvidia’s VR200 NVL72 platform requires ~600,000 MLCCs per server, over 30% more than GB300. Combined with the +182% value increase in the BOM, this underscores tightening supply for high-capacitance, high-reliability MLCCs in power delivery and decoupling for AI accelerators. Optical Communication: 800G/1.6T Ramp Accelerating Chinese leader Zhongji Innolight reported Q1 2026 net profit +262% YoY, driven by strong 800G/1.6T shipments, with expectations of significant full-year growth. This mirrors industry-wide momentum as AI clusters shift toward higher-speed optics for reduced latency and power in scale-out/scale-up networking. Nvidia’s investments in photonics and CPO further validate the trend. US Representatives: • Coherent (COHR) and Lumentum (LITE): Key players in optical components and transceivers; Nvidia has made substantial equity investments to secure capacity. • Corning (GLW): Major beneficiary via optical fiber, connectivity, and glass technologies (detailed below). 4. Micro-LED/Glass Substrates & Optical Interconnects: Strategic Partnerships Accelerating On May 20, 2026, BOE announced a cooperation MOU with Corning covering glass-based encapsulation carriers, foldable glass, perovskite substrates, and optical interconnect applications. This aligns with industry shifts toward glass cores for superior flatness, thermal stability, and integration in advanced packaging and photonics—critical for next-gen AI as organic substrates hit limits. US Representative: Corning (GLW) – Central to Nvidia’s optical strategy with multi-billion partnerships, new US optical factories, and expansion in fiber/photonics for AI data centers. Recent deals position GLW for 10x+ capacity growth in key areas. AI systems are teaching themselves skills they were never trained to have. Here's the example that Eric Schmidt explained: A Google AI was prompted in Bengali. A language it was never trained on. With only a small amount of prompting, it suddenly could translate the entire Bengali language. Nobody programmed that. It just emerged on its own. Schmidt calls this "the black box problem." You don't fully understand what the model learned. You can't always tell why it got something right or why it got something wrong. The field has theories but the honest answer is: we turned it loose on society before we fully understood it. His defense: "We don't fully understand how a human mind works either." This isn't just a safety conversation. It's a business one. The companies that solve interpretability, not just raw performance, are going to be worth an enormous amount. Understanding why a model does what it does is becoming a regulatory requirement and eventually a customer trust issue. Right now the AI race is won on benchmark scores. The next phase of the race gets won on explainability.
